• The University of Ibadan accepts students with only 200 and above for all departments, unless otherwise annulled by JAMB.

• The University of Ibadan (UI) accepts candidates using awaiting results during the admission process but must upload their O'level results before the commencement of giving of admission after the post utme exam due to the fact that O-level is part of its admission process.

• University of Ibadan (UI) accepts a combination of O-level results in its admission (Except for Law and courses in the College of Medicine)

• The University Of Ibadan (UI) post-utme grading is over 100%.

• University of Ibadan (UI) post-utme consists of 100 questions in all, with 25 questions per subject for the UTME taken subjects.

• According to last year's 2021 Post Utme examination, UI post-utme is now a Computer based examination.

• University of Ibadan (UI) post-utme lasts for 1 hour and 30 minutes.

• After registering for UI post-utme, you should print your slip, which bears vital significance.

The University of Ibadan (UI) Post UTME is a multiple-choice question exam.

University of Ibadan Post Utme Subject Combination

UI uses the JAMB subject combination. It means you will write the same subjects in your screening exam as your JAMB exams.

For example, let’s say you are applying to study Electrical Engineering at UI.

Your Post UTME subject combination will be the Use of English, Physics, Mathematics and Chemistry.

Post UTME Exam Format

The University of Ibadan (UI) exam format is 100 questions for 1 hour and 30 minutes.

You will answer twenty-five (25) questions for each subject combination.

How to Calculate UI Aggregate Score

To calculate your UI Aggregate score, Divide your JAMB score by eight (8) and your Post UTME score by 2 to calculate the UI aggregate score.

For example, let’s assume you have a JAMB score of 250 and a Post UTME score of 68;

JAMB = 250/8 = 31.25
Post UTME = 68/2 = 34
Aggregate = 65.25.
